The U.S. Department of Defense, through DCSO-P New Cumberland, is seeking an up to eight-month lease of 79 ONE-Net Multi-Functional Devices (MFDs) located in Bahrain, along with associated maintenance services and supplies excluding paper, to bridge the gap until replacement units under a previously awarded follow-on contract are delivered and installed by no later than April 30, 2027. The government does not own the currently deployed MFDs and is not acquiring ownership through this action; the arrangement is strictly a short-term rental to maintain operational continuity. This acquisition is being conducted on a sole source basis with Business International WLL, though all responsible sources may submit quotations for consideration. The solicitation, identified as SP700026Q1024, falls under NAICS code 532420 and was posted on July 20, 2026, with responses due no later than July 22, 2026. DCSO-P New Cumberland has a requirement for an up to 8-month continued lease of 79 ONE-Net Multi-Functional Devices (MFDs) with associated maintenance services and supplies (excluding paper) for OCONUS – Bahrain until devices under the already awarded follow-on contract can be delivered and installed, anticipated to be no later than 04/30/2027. The Government does not own the 79 MFDs that are currently in place and included in this short-term acquisition. This acquisition is being solicited on a sole source basis with Business International WLL. All responsible sources may submit quotations which shall be considered by the agency.
